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ky

Domáce Hardware Siete Programovanie Softvér Otázka Systémy

Čo je Array Programovanie

? Počítačové programy ukladajú dáta v rôznych smeroch . Tieto možnosti ukladania umožňujú programátorom vytvárať a prístup k dátovej štruktúry v rámci svojich aplikácií . Jedným z najjednoduchších ukladanie dát položky v programovaní je premenná . Premenné ukladať jednotlivé položky dát . Pole je iný typ dátovej štruktúry , ukladanie rady hodnôt v po sebe nasledujúcich polohách . Potom, čo program má štruktúru poľa v ňom , môže vstúpiť a prístup k hodnotám v špecifických polohách poľa . Dátové

Väčšina počítačových programov použiť nejaký údajov . Napríklad , aplikácia pre ukladanie a prístup k evidencii zamestnancov pre organizáciu je potrebné modelovať dáta do týchto záznamov . Tento model musí umožniť kód aplikácie pre prístup k dátam v organizovaným spôsobom . Keď počítačový program používa dáta , je potrebné možnosť pridať nové dáta , zmeniť existujúce dátové položky a vyhľadávať jednotlivé položky pomocou dotazu na dáta . An ukladá pole dáta v lineárnej štruktúre , s každým prvkom pristupovať pomocou svojho indexu , ktorý je často celočíselná hodnota reprezentujúca pozíciu v rámci štruktúry ako celku .
Premenné

Programovacie jazyky poskytujú možnosť ukladať jednotlivé kusy dát ako premenné . V niektorých jazykoch , ako je Java , premenné musia byť deklarovaný ako určitý typ , napríklad textový reťazec alebo celé číslo , rovnako ako v nasledujúcich príkladoch :

String myWords = " tam ahoj " ; int myNum = 3 ;

v mnohých iných jazykoch , môžete premenné ukladať hodnoty akéhokoľvek typu , ako v nasledujúcom príklade PHP :

$ my_value = " jablko " ;

poľa v program sa skladá z radu hodnôt , takže element v každej pozícii v poli je podobný jednej premennej . Programy môžu vykonávať rovnaké procesy na prvky poľa ako na premenné .
Array Vytvorenie

Keď program vytvorí pole , bude zvyčajne naznačujú niektoré aspekty matice , ktorá je zase reprezentovaný ako premenné v rámci aplikácie . Nasledujúci ukážkový kód v jazyku Java demonštruje vytvorenie poľa pre uloženie určitý počet celočíselných hodnôt :

int [ ] myNums = new int [ 6 ] ;

Toto pole môže obsahovať šesť hodnôt typu integer . Pokiaľ tento riadok kódu je vykonaný , program má prázdnu štruktúru poľa , ale žiadne hodnoty sú uložené v niektorej z prvkov pozícií ešte .
Element inštancie

programy môžete vložiť a meniť hodnoty v jednotlivých pozíciách poľa . Nasledujúci ukážkový kód v jazyku Java demonštruje nastavenie prvok na prvú pozíciu v rámci celej číslo poľa , ktoré je reprezentované indexom nula : Spojené

myNums [ 0 ] = 5 ;

Tento kód sa vzťahuje na prvok pomocou názvu poľa a postavenie , potom priradí hodnotu . Ak je prvok už mal hodnotu uloženú v tejto pozícii , ktorá hodnota bude prepísaná novou .
Array Prístup

programy občas potrebujú prístup všetky položky pole , skôr ako jednoducho prístup jednotlivé prvky pomocou ich indexu hodnoty . Ak chcete iterovat prvky v poli , programy často používajú slučkové štruktúry . Nasledujúci ukážkový kód v jazyku Java demonštruje použitie " pre " slučky na výstup každého prvku v poli :

for ( int i = 0 ; i < myNums.length , i + + ) { System.out.println ( myNums [ i ] ) ; }

Tento kód vykoná raz pre každú pozíciu pole , písanie sa hodnoty v tejto polohe zakaždým
.

Najnovšie články

Copyright © počítačové znalosti Všetky práva vyhradené